- 产品›
- Amazon ElastiCache›
- Amazon ElastiCache for Redis – 全球数据存储
Amazon ElastiCache for Redis – 全球数据存储
概述
Amazon ElastiCache for Redis 全球数据存储提供完全托管、快速且安全可靠的跨区域复制。借助全球数据存储,您可以在一个区域中将数据写入 ElastiCache for Redis 集群,并使数据可从另一个跨区域副本集群读取,从而在中国的两个区域实现低延迟读取和灾难恢复。
Redis 全球数据存储专为实时应用程序而设计,通过在更靠近最终用户的地理位置提供本地读取,实现通常不到 1 秒的跨区域复制延迟,从而提高应用程序的响应速度。如果遇到很少出现的区域降级情况,可以将另一正常运行的跨区域副本集群升级为具有完整读/写功能的主集群。启动后,升级通常会在不到 1 分钟的时间内完成,确保您的应用程序保持可用状态。为确保跨区域数据传输的安全,全球数据存储采用传输中加密。
要设置全球数据存储,您可以从现有集群开始,也可以创建一个新集群用作主集群。您只需在 ElastiCache 的亚马逊云科技管理控制台中单击几下,即可创建全球数据存储,也可以通过下载最新的亚马逊云科技开发工具包或 CLI 来自动创建。Amazon CloudFormation 也已支持全球数据存储。
技术文档
如需了解更多信息,请参阅《Amazon ElastiCache for Redis 用户指南》中的 Amazon ElastiCache 全球数据存储文档。
优势
本地写入,全球读取
借助全球数据存储,您可以在一个区域中将数据写入 ElastiCache for Redis 集群,并使数据可从另一个跨区域副本集群读取,从而实现低延迟本地读取。由于跨区域复制延迟通常不到 1 秒,因此您的应用程序可以实现快速的跨区域数据访问。
跨区域灾难恢复
如果遇到很少出现的区域降级情况,可以在不到 1 分钟的时间内将全球数据存储中的另一个跨区域副本集群升级为具有完整读写功能的主集群,确保您的应用程序保持可用状态。
卓越性能
利用 Redis 为主区域本地读写和辅助区域本地读取提供的亚毫秒级延迟。
安全
Redis 全球数据存储对跨区域流量使用传输中加密,以确保数据安全。此外,您还可以使用静态加密对主集群和辅助集群进行加密,以确保端到端的数据安全。每个主集群和辅助集群都可以在 Amazon Key Management Service(KMS)中单独拥有一个客户管理的客户主密钥(CMK),以进行静态加密。
易于设置
全球数据存储消除了跨两个中国区域在集群中部署、管理和复制数据的复杂性和运营负担。要设置全球数据存储,您可以从现有集群开始,也可以创建一个新集群用作主集群。您只需在 ElastiCache 的 Amazon ElastiCache 管理控制台中点击几次,即可创建面向 Redis 的全球数据存储,也可以通过下载最新的亚马逊云科技开发工具包或 CLI 来自动创建。
一键式无缝配置更改
全球数据存储使您可以轻松扩展或升级区域集群,并确保所有参与集群均配置相同。您还可以轻松地将辅助区域升级为主区域。完成所有配置更改后,全球数据存储确保跨区域复制得到正确设置,将数据从主集群复制到辅助集群。